Legal rights for animals remain a radical frontier. To have a right, a being must generally have standing to sue. Currently, a cow cannot walk into a courtroom. An animal rights attorney must prove the animal is a legal "person." This has succeeded in very limited cases: in 2016, an Argentine court granted a chimpanzee named Cecilia habeas corpus rights, moving her from a zoo to a sanctuary.
